Output 862301e4b371263f93fcbbf008778bdf1a4063c41c3244eee23397fa1798d6c6:22

value
26292
script pubkey
OP_0 OP_PUSHBYTES_20 cec8eaa8895ad4c7b7cb734ace1b6eac0a67fc27
address
bc1qemyw42yftt2v0d7twd9vuxmw4s9x0lp8upghgu
transaction
862301e4b371263f93fcbbf008778bdf1a4063c41c3244eee23397fa1798d6c6
spent
true